All Favourites Comic #20

Aug 1960 · K. G. Murray · 2/- [0-2-0 AUP]
☆ Be the first to review + Add to your collection — Join free

In "The Creatures from the Past," the team joins June and Dr. Henry in their quest for the Golden Fleece, unaware that wielding it awakens ancient powers—Rocky soon finds himself summoning mythical beasts, from a flame-breathing dragon to a cyclops and a mermaid. Written by Dave Wood and illustrated by Bob Brown, this 1960 adventure blends myth and mystery, with cover art by Bob Brown capturing the thrilling moment the Fleece is found.

Trial by Magic
7 pp · Western-Frontier

In "Trial by Magic," Dan, a lone traveler in the frontier town of Fort Desolation, sets out to find a missing circus that never arrived. When he discovers they were diverted by Comanche warriors and forced to perform, he joins their act as a juggler—his swirling torches igniting teepees in a moment of chaos. Captured and imprisoned in a swinging cage for target practice, Dan’s daring escape leads him back to the circus, where he finally takes the stage to dazzle the crowd with his skills.

Reprints

↩ Reprints Mr. District Attorney #25 (1952), Tomahawk #31 (1955), Western Comics #55 (1956), All Star Western #109 (1959), Showcase #24 (1960), The Fox and the Crow #60 (1960), My Greatest Adventure #41 (1960), Challengers of the Unknown #13 (1960), Showcase #26 (1960), Wonder Woman #114 (1960)
